Liquid Treatment Systems : Combining Electrical Deionization, RO , and Microfiltration

Modern liquid purification equipment frequently blend multiple methods to realize exceptional cleanness. For example, a prevalent configuration includes microfiltration as a first step to eliminate larger particles , followed by membrane filtration to eliminate dissolved minerals and then EDI for final conditioning and reliable resistivity lowering . This holistic approach delivers a highly superior solution for demanding applications requiring exceptional liquid cleanness.

Maximizing Filter Duration: Recommended Techniques for RO Systems, Ultrafiltration, and Electrodeionization

To obtain sustained performance and lessen replacement costs for your RO , ultrafiltration, and electrodeionization units, implementing best practices is essential. Regular cleaning is necessary, employing suitable cleaning agents based on contaminant nature. Pre-treatment procedures must be carefully checked and optimized to limit media fouling. Moreover, maintaining correct operating head and rate inside the supplier's recommended limits is crucial for increasing media longevity.
